Are you exhausted by shame-based Christianity, constant conviction, and feeling like you can never “measure up” to God? In this episode, we talk about religious trauma, spiritual bypassing, inner healing, nervous system healing, and why so many Christians stay stuck in cycles of fear, shame, condemnation, and self-hatred instead of experiencing true freedom in Christ.
In today’s episode of Red Hot Truth Ministry, we dive deep into the difference between conviction and condemnation, trauma and sin, and why healing the root matters if we truly want transformation. Michelle shares her personal testimony of healing from complex PTSD, chronic illness, narcissistic abuse, religious shame, and nervous system dysregulation through Jesus, inner healing, deliverance, and renewing the mind.
